Chrysler-Chery alliance to be finalized in Beijing tomorrow

The long-awaited merger between Chrysler and Chinese automaker Chery will be finalized in Beijing tomorrow, Reuters is reporting. The deal floated in and out of the news as Chrysler was sold to Cerberus Capital Management by DaimlerChrysler AG, but now that's everything is about to be squared away, the importation of China-built vehicles to the U.S. will be that much closer to reality.
